Written by: Bob Dylan
Recorded in 1961
From: "The Bootleg Series Volumes 1-3. 1961-1991 [Disc 1]"
Tabbed by: maguri
Tuning: Standard
Very laconic and beautiful. The guitar alternates between two main patterns
(pattern 1 featuring slight variations here and there, pattern 2 pretty much
stays the same throughout the song). The bass is played with the thumb and
the chords are strummed.
Pattern 1 G [2/4] e|---3--------3---|----3-------3---|----3-------3---|--------| B|---3--------3---|----3-------3---|----3-------3---|--------| G|---0--------0---|----0-------0---|----0-------0---|--------| D|--------0-------|----------------|--------0-------|----0---| A|----------------|-------0h2------|----------------|--------| E|3---------------|3---------------|3---------------|3-------| [4/4] Em e|----0-----------|----0-------0---| B|----0-----------|----0-------0---| G|----0-----------|----0-------0---| D|----2-----------|----2-------2---| A|------------0h2-|----------------| E|0---------------|0---------------| Pattern 2 G [2/4] e|---3--------3---|---3--------3---|---3--------3---|----3---| B|---3--------3---|---3--------3---|---3--------3---|----3---| G|---0--------0---|---0--------0---|---0--------0---|----0---| D|--------0-------|2-------0-------|----------------|----2---| A|----------------|----------------|0h2-------------|2-------| E|3---------------|----------------|-------3--------|--------| [4/4] Em e|----0-----------|----0-------0---| B|----0-----------|----0-------0---| G|----0-----------|----0-------0---| D|----2-------2---|----2-------2---| A|----------------|----------------| E|0---------------|0---------------| CODA Em e|----0-----------|--------0-------| B|----0-----------|--------0-------| G|----0-----------|--------0-------| D|----2-----------|--------2-------| A|------------0h2-|--------2-------| E|0---------------|0-------0-------|
